Output e70c790e4d8a99d290f084e6c94a17019ddac9f27b668e05812c219ad5681780:41

value
109301
script pubkey
OP_0 OP_PUSHBYTES_32 d8f5ac438378155fdffb6ae56dc40841fd273606160e2e43fab97d7c61b17148
address
bc1qmr66csur0q24lhlmdtjkm3qgg87jwdsxzc8zusl6h97hccd3w9yqrzn6vf
transaction
e70c790e4d8a99d290f084e6c94a17019ddac9f27b668e05812c219ad5681780
spent
true